The Fiji Police Force has announced that there were no incidents of a stabbing at Albert Park last night. Assistant Commissioner of Police – Operations, Livai Driu, stated that officers were present at the concert venue from early evening until it concluded, and there have been no reports of a stabbing related to the event.

Driu highlighted that a social media post claimed such an incident occurred, and officers stationed at the venue were assigned to verify these claims. They confirmed that no stabbing took place, nor was there any incident requiring police intervention.

The public is encouraged to report any concerns directly to the police, as unfounded claims can lead to unnecessary panic and anxiety.
